Leverage
Leverage (lev"ẽr*aj o lē"vẽr*aj) , noun
The action of a lever; mechanical advantage gained by the lever.
Collocations (2)
Leverage of a couple (Mechanics) , the perpendicular distance between the lines of action of two forces which act in parallel and opposite directions.
Leverage of a force , the perpendicular distance from the line in which a force acts upon a body to a point about which the body may be supposed to turn.
